Game Overview

An ancient shrine becomes a tense nocturnal maze when a stray cat crosses its threshold and finds the way home erased by a repeating night. Cat in Temple is a compact indie horror-leaning exploration game built around observation rather than combat, using shifting architecture, spectral yokai, and subtle environmental changes to create constant unease. Its premise is simple but effective: the cat retraces the same grounds again and again, while the temple quietly stops obeying reality. The mood sits somewhere between Japanese ghost-story folklore and the anxious anomaly spotting of modern looping horror games.

Players guide the cat through familiar corridors and paths, watching closely for anything that looks wrong: a changed object, an unnatural presence, or a route that no longer feels safe. The first cycle establishes the correct direction, but later runs demand a choice between continuing on a normal-looking path or turning back when an anomaly appears. Progress depends on making ten correct decisions in a row, and a single bad call wipes that streak completely, giving each journey real pressure despite the small-scale setting. There is no indication of combat or character upgrading; success comes from memory, patience, and recognizing details before the temple catches you off guard.

What makes Cat in Temple stand out is its use of a cat-sized perspective and a restrained supernatural setting instead of loud jump scares or elaborate survival systems. Repeated runs make players learn the layout, yet the changing anomalies ensure that familiarity becomes a source of suspicion rather than comfort. The short-session structure and harsh reset rule make it especially appealing to players who enjoy anomaly games such as The Exit 8, but want a darker folklore flavor and a more focused challenge. Newcomers can understand its rules quickly, while veterans of observation-driven horror may appreciate trying to maintain a flawless ten-run streak.
